where to plant Centaurea raphanina subsp. mixta

  • height: 20-30 cm
  • flowering: June - August
  • color: purple
  • leaf color: gray-green
  • habit: rosette
  • growth: medium
  • level: difficult
  • light: full sun sunny
  • moisture: dry winter dry
  • soil texture: pervious light
  • organic matter: none to little
  • pH: limy
  • winter zone: 7 [-15°C]
  • density: 8 - 12

Centaurea raphanina subsp. mixta in the garden

  • wildlife: for bees

botanical information about Centaurea raphanina subsp. mixta

  • Botanical name: Centaurea raphanina subsp. mixta
  • Genus: Centaurea
  • Family: Asteraceae
  • origin: Europe, South
